Bug#797979: Again



I have discovered it is somehow related to the dual monitor settings. When I plugged external monitor before login (during a time when the sddm is on screen) I was able to start plasma desktop in dual monitor mode. But then when I unplugged the monitor, then notebook LCD gone black and only thing you can do is reboot (plugging in external monitor doesn't help). So I repeated the previous step with the external monitor plugged in during login. (Frankly I didn't try login without but I tested that unplugging ends with black screen again.) But then I rebooted with the external monitor plugged in but when grub appeared I unplugged the external monitor and was able to login and it works now!
